The Very Hungry Caterpillar

Kids learn to count with the hungry caterpillar as he eats his way through one apple (and the pages of the book itself) on Monday, two pears on Tuesday, and more until it bursts into a beautiful butterfly! (Ages 2-4)

The card security code is an added safeguard for your credit/debit card purchases. Depending on the type of card you use, it is either a three- or four-digit number printed on the back or front of your credit/debit card, separate from your credit/debit card number. To make shopping at Doubleday Book Club® even more secure, we require that you enter this number each time you make a credit/debit card purchase. Please note that your security code will not be stored with us even if you have saved your credit/debit card information.
